1. Fortinet EMS: The API Bypass (CVE-2026-35616)
The most severe threat currently facing network administrators is CVE-2026-35616, a critical vulnerability in FortiClient Endpoint Management Server (EMS). With a near-perfect CVSS score of 9.8, this flaw is a direct ticket to the heart of an organization's endpoint security.
- The Vulnerability: An improper access control flaw in the FortiClient EMS API allows an unauthenticated, remote attacker to bypass authentication checks.
- The Impact: By sending a specially crafted HTTP request, an attacker can execute arbitrary code or commands on the EMS server. Since the EMS manages security policies for every connected device in the company, a compromise here allows an attacker to disable endpoint protections globally or deploy ransomware across the entire network.
- Active Status: CISA has already added this to its Known Exploited Vulnerabilities (KEV) catalog. Intelligence suggests roughly 2,000 internet-exposed instances are currently vulnerable.
Immediate Action: If you are running FortiClient EMS 7.4.5 or 7.4.6, apply the emergency hotfix immediately or upgrade to 7.4.7.
2. Google Chrome: The WebGPU "Dawn" Zero-Day (CVE-2026-5281)
On the desktop front, Google has rushed out a patch for its fourth actively exploited zero-day of 2026. This high-severity flaw, tracked as CVE-2026-5281, targets Dawn, the open-source implementation of the WebGPU standard.
- The Exploit: This is a use-after-free bug. An attacker can trigger it by tricking a user into visiting a maliciously crafted website.
- The Goal: If successful, the attacker can break out of the browser's renderer process and execute arbitrary code on the victim's machine.
- The Frequency: The fact that this is the fourth zero-day since January underscores the intense pressure browser engines are under as AI-driven discovery tools (like Anthropic Mythos) begin to map complex browser internals at scale.
Immediate Action: Update Chrome to version 146.0.7680.178 (or higher) on Windows and macOS. Chromium-based browsers like Edge, Brave, and Opera are also affected.
3. Adobe Acrobat: The "Russian Lure" (CVE-2026-34621)
Not to be outdone, Adobe has released an emergency out-of-band patch for Acrobat and Reader to address CVE-2026-34621.
- The Campaign: This zero-day has been circulating since at least November 2025. It gained the "Russian Lure" moniker because attackers have been using Russian-language PDFs—specifically targeting the oil and gas sector—to deliver the payload.
- The Logic: The flaw involves prototype pollution in the JavaScript engine, allowing for RCE simply by opening a PDF.
- Priority: Adobe has labeled this as Priority 1. Ensure you are on version 26.001.21411 or later.
Technical Tip: For the Fortinet flaw, check your logs for unusual HTTP requests targeting the EMS API endpoints. If your EMS is internet-facing, consider restricting access to known management IPs via a firewall until the patch is verified
